What is the Mayors Wellness Campaign?

The Mayors Wellness Campaign (MWC) is a statewide community health initiative that provides evidence-based tools and strategies for mayors and community leaders to help their residents achieve healthier lifestyles and to improve overall health and wellness in their communities. The New Jersey Health Care Quality Institute has been leading the Mayors Wellness Campaign in partnership with the New Jersey State League of Municipalities since 2006.
